JOB OVERVIEW:

This role supports the mission and Core Values of HGC Industries by performing the final quality checks before HGC products ship to the customer. The Final Inspector inspects and measures parts during the final audit/inspection to verify that they meet quality standards. After parts pass inspection, assist in preparing parts for shipping following customer and HGC guidelines. In instances where parts do not meet quality standards, troubleshoot the parts and reject them back to production for re-inspection.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:  

  • Responsible for conducting the final quality check on all Hoosier Gasket products before they are shipped to customers.
  • Uses measuring equipment correctly and with consistent accuracy. This includes the following:
    • Calipers
    • Micrometers
    • Mylar overlays
  • Demonstrate a strong ability to read and interpret engineer drawings.
  • Records quality data accurately on forms/documents, as required.
  • Reject parts that do not meet quality criteria and send them back for re-inspection.
  • Assists in preparing parts that passed final inspection for shipment, following customer and HGC guidelines.

PHYSICAL DEMANDS:

  • The person in this role will be consistently required to: bend/crouch, carry objects, climb, handle/manipulate objects, lift (50 lbs. maximum), kneel, push/pull, engage rapid reflex movements (such as catching parts from a press), reach, sit, standing for long periods, and walking.                             

ENVIRONMENTAL CONDITIONS:

Fast-paced, deadline-oriented manufacturing plant and office. The person will be exposed to noise, dirt, dust, fumes, odors, chemicals, and other airborne particles.  They will use heavy machinery and/or hand or power tools.  Will work with or near dry ice, CO2 gas, and/or silicone.  Wear protective clothing/equipment.  May work in areas of extreme heat.
